Title :
Integrated external cavity laser composed of spot-size converted LD and UV written grating in silica waveguide on Si

Abstract :
The authors report for the first time an external cavity laser composed of a spot-size converted LD and a UV written waveguide grating, both integrated on Si. The laser operates in a single mode with a side-mode suppression of 37 dB. The threshold current is 12 mA and the average thermal coefficient is as low as -1.7 GHz
